Decoding APR vs Interest Rate

The most important metric you should understand is how APR works. The APR rate for loans shows the actual expense of borrowing, plus all charges. Unlike the base rate, the rate gives a comprehensive view of what you'll actually pay.

The difference between your rate and APR proves substantial. For authoritative loan terms comparison example, a loan might have 5% in interest but an 8% annual rate, including the additional initial costs charged. Our loan APR calculator to evaluate rates prior to borrowing.

Detailing Loan Fees Explained

Separate from your rate, consumers typically pay various fees. The typical loan fees explained:

  • Loan Processing Fees: Assessed upfront to pay the cost of processing your loan request
  • Early Payoff Charges: Applied if you pay off your loan before the term ends
  • Missed Payment Charges: Assessed when payments your payment
  • Yearly Charges: Some loans require annual payments for account maintenance the account

Understanding these costs enables you to figure out your total financial obligation. Comparing different offers between providers reveals significant variation in what you'll pay.

Evaluating Your Loan Terms

Before you decide on specific products, examine the complete breakdown provided by lenders. The length of your agreement greatly impacts what you pay monthly and the interest you'll pay. A shorter term generally provides bigger monthly costs but reduced total charges.

What distinguishes between interest rates and APR? The base rate is just the cost of the money borrowed itself. Your APR includes extra expenses, providing a comprehensive picture of the total obligation.

What do you mean prepayment penalty and why do companies assess? Many creditors assess an amount should you settle the loan early, since they won't receive the interest income planned to collect. Always check for these fees before taking out a loan.
